Autonomic dysfunction and cardiovascular risk in post-traumatic stress disorder
1Institute for Exercise and Environmental Medicine, Texas Health Presbyterian Hospital Dallas, Internal Medicine, University of Texas Southwestern Medical Center, Dallas, TX, United States of America.
Post-traumatic stress disorder (PTSD) is linked to cardiovascular disease risk due to impaired autonomic function. Autonomic imbalance and baroreflex impairments in PTSD may explain this increased cardiovascular risk.
Area of Science:
- Cardiology
- Psychiatry
- Neuroscience
Background:
- Patients with post-traumatic stress disorder (PTSD) exhibit a higher risk of cardiovascular disease.
- The precise mechanisms linking PTSD, autonomic dysfunction, and cardiovascular risk are not fully understood.
- Existing research presents conflicting findings regarding autonomic function alterations in PTSD.
Purpose of the Study:
- To review current knowledge on autonomic function and cardiovascular risk in patients with PTSD.
- To explore the relationship between PTSD, autonomic dysfunction, and cardiovascular disease.
- To synthesize findings on sympathetic and parasympathetic nervous system activity in PTSD.
Main Methods:
- A comprehensive literature search was conducted on PubMed.
- Keywords included autonomic function, heart rate variability, blood pressure variability, sympathetic activity, baroreflex function, and cardiovascular risk in PTSD.
- Studies published between 2000 and 2021 were selected for review.
Main Results:
- A significant portion of studies indicate heightened sympathetic and reduced parasympathetic nervous system activity (autonomic imbalance) in PTSD patients.
- Evidence suggests impaired baroreflex function in PTSD, contributing to blood pressure dysregulation.
- PTSD chronicity and symptom severity are identified as independent risk factors for cardiovascular disease, potentially mediated by autonomic dysfunction.
Conclusions:
- Increased cardiovascular risk in PTSD may be associated with autonomic dysfunction.
- Further research is needed to determine if autonomic dysfunction can serve as a biomarker for PTSD onset and progression.
- The potential role of autonomic imbalance in increasing the risk of developing PTSD requires investigation.
